1984 Audi 5000 vs. 1994 Ferrari 512 TR
To start off, 1994 Ferrari 512 TR is newer by 10 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1984 Audi 5000.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1984 Audi 5000 would be higher. At 4,943 cc, 1994 Ferrari 512 TR is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 1994 Ferrari 512 TR (423 HP) has 322 more horse power than 1984 Audi 5000. (101 HP) In normal driving conditions, 1994 Ferrari 512 TR should accelerate faster than 1984 Audi 5000.
Because 1984 Audi 5000 is four wheel drive (4WD), it will have significant more traction and grip than 1994 Ferrari 512 TR. In wet, icy, snow, or gravel driving conditions, 1984 Audi 5000 will offer significantly more control.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 1994 Ferrari 512 TR (501 Nm) has 365 more torque (in Nm) than 1984 Audi 5000. (136 Nm). This means 1994 Ferrari 512 TR will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 1984 Audi 5000.
Compare all specifications:
1984 Audi 5000 | 1994 Ferrari 512 TR | |
Make | Audi | Ferrari |
Model | 5000 | 512 TR |
Year Released | 1984 | 1994 |
Engine Position | Front | Middle |
Engine Size | 2144 cc | 4943 cc |
Horse Power | 101 HP | 423 HP |
Torque | 136 Nm | 501 Nm |
Engine Bore Size | 78.5 mm | 82 mm |
Engine Stroke Size | 86.4 mm | 78 mm |
Drive Type | 4WD | Rear |
Transmission Type | Manual | Manual |
Number of Seats | 5 seats | 2 seats |
Vehicle Length | 4800 mm | 4490 mm |
Vehicle Width | 1770 mm | 1980 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1400 mm | 1140 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 2690 mm | 2560 mm |
